Minx Valour loves a
challenge.
 
And the biggest entertainment
show of the year is offering a once in a lifetime opportunity to the winner.
 
It’s the prize of a lifetime!

Glamorous blonde, Minx
Valour requires one Golden Star and she will get the opportunity to spend a
week with any celebrity she chooses in the entire world.
 

The Game Show will
approach royalty, a rock star, movie star or tycoon and offer them a donation
of 10 million dollars to a charity of their choice, should they accept spending
a week with the winner.
  

The shipping and
property tycoon, Stanley Marx is a notorious recluse. The tormented billionaire
lives in seclusion since the tragic death of his wife and son and has not been
seen in public in years.
 
Would he agree
to spend a week with a perfectly groomed curvaceous model and budding
journalist?
 
Minx Valour is determined to
find out what happened that fateful night ten years ago and get the scoop most
journalists can only dream of!
